Section 2712.23 | Obligation to disclose information.

...The obligation to disclose information set forth in section 2712.22 of the Revised Code is mandatory and cannot be waived as to the parties with respect to persons serving either as the sole arbitrator or sole conciliator or as the chief or prevailing arbitrator or conciliator. The parties otherwise may agree to waive the disclosure.

Section 2712.24 | Continuing duty to disclose questionable impartiality.

...From the time of appointment and throughout the arbitral proceedings, an arbitrator immediately shall disclose to the parties any circumstances referred to in section 2712.22 of the Revised Code that previously were not disclosed.

Section 2712.33 | Exceeding scope of authority plea.

...A plea that the arbitral tribunal is exceeding the scope of its authority shall be raised as soon as the matter alleged to be beyond the scope of its authority is raised during the arbitral proceedings.

Section 2712.34 | Admission of later plea.

...In either of the cases referred to in sections 2712.32 and 2712.33 of the Revised Code, the arbitral tribunal may admit a later plea if it considers the delay justified. The arbitral tribunal may rule on a later plea either as a preliminary question or in an award on the merits.

Section 2712.38 | Agreement for procedure.

...Subject to the provisions of this chapter, the parties may agree on the procedure to be followed by the arbitral tribunal in conducting the proceedings.

Section 2712.39 | Tribunal to determine procedure.

...(A) Failing any agreement referred to in section 2712.38 of the Revised Code, the arbitral tribunal may conduct the arbitration in the manner it considers appropriate, subject to the provisions of this chapter. (B) The power of the arbitral tribunal under this section includes the power to determine the admissibility, relevance, materiality, and weight of any evidence.
